Our Gate Access Control Services in Mayflower Village
Keypad Entry Systems
Keypad entry in Mayflower Village typically costs $320–$580 installed, or $180–$340 for repair and reprogramming. The affluent homeowner concentration here drives demand for premium keypads — DoorKing 1812s, Elite SL3000s, vandal-resistant stainless housings. We service whatever you’ve got. The hard San Gabriel basin groundwater corrodes zinc keypad contacts faster than you’d expect; we see this quarterly on eastern Mayflower Village properties. When we replace, we spec marine-grade terminals and stainless hardware to outlast the local chemistry.

Common Gate Access Control Problems We See in Mayflower Village Homes
- Santa Ana wind torque on gate frames. Seasonal Santa Ana wind events funnel through the San Gabriel Valley foothills and regularly torque gate frames, stress welds, and knock slide-gate tracks out of alignment. The access control sensors and limit switches mounted to these frames go out of calibration, causing intermittent operation or false obstruction errors.
- Hard groundwater corrosion of operator hardware. The mineral-rich groundwater common to the San Gabriel basin accelerates rust on wrought iron components and corrodes the zinc hardware on automatic gate operators faster than coastal LA climates. We replace with stainless or galvanized equivalents that survive the local chemistry.
- Foundation failure under upgraded gate loads. Older post footings from original installs can’t support newer heavy automated gates, causing hinge alignment shifts and foundation cracks. The access control arm or slide mechanism binds, overloads the motor, and eventually burns out the control board — a $600+ failure preventable with proper post reinforcement.
- Permit delays from jurisdictional confusion. Because Mayflower Village falls under unincorporated LA County jurisdiction, technicians pulling permits for gate motor or structural post work must use the LA County DPW portal — not Arcadia’s city system. We’ve rescued multiple jobs stalled when out-of-area contractors filed with the wrong jurisdiction.
Pricing for Gate Access Control in Mayflower Village, CA
| Service | Typical Range in Mayflower Village |
|---|---|
| Keypad repair/reprogramming | $180 – $340 |
| Keypad replacement (installed) | $320 – $580 |
| Remote programming | $95 – $150 |
| Remote receiver replacement | $180 – $220 |
| Phone entry repair | $340 – $720 |
| Card reader install | $480 – $1,200+ |
| Video intercom install | $650 – $1,400 |
| Smart access retrofit | $380 – $890 |
| Full access control system replacement | $1,800 – $4,500 |
What moves you within these ranges? Brand availability (European brands like FAAC and BFT cost more to source quickly), whether your existing wiring is reusable, and whether we need to pull LA County DPW permits for structural or electrical work.
